I wanted to explore the Barbadian tradition of stick licking based on a story I heard from an old fighter when I was a boy. He told tales of gangs of fighters who would go from village to village to challenge each other. He told us listening that the gang would enter the village in a particular order. The weakest first, the strongest last. While he did not refer to the leader as a Bad John he did talk about some rogue fighters who had to be put in their place and the epic battles that took place. I had only to find a narrative for the battle and I had to look no further than a rum shop. Even in my time as a boy long after stick fighting was popular fights would break out at the rum shops in my village.
